LGTV Companion:让你的LG电视与Windows电脑智能联动的终极指南
【免费下载链接】LGTVCompanionPower On and Off WebOS LG TVs together with your PC项目地址: https://gitcode.com/gh_mirrors/lg/LGTVCompanion
你是否厌倦了每次使用电脑连接电视时都要手动开关机?是否担心OLED电视作为显示器使用时可能出现的烧屏问题?LGTV Companion正是为解决这些问题而生的开源智能控制工具。这款强大的Windows应用程序能让你的LG WebOS电视与电脑实现完美同步,自动响应电源事件,为OLED屏幕提供智能保护,并带来无缝的用户体验。
🎯 为什么你需要LGTV Companion?
现代OLED电视作为电脑显示器使用时面临着独特的挑战。静态的桌面界面、长时间固定的任务栏和浏览器标签页都可能对OLED像素造成永久性损伤。同时,手动管理电视电源状态既繁琐又容易忘记。LGTV Companion通过智能自动化解决了这些痛点:
核心功能亮点:
- 自动电源管理:电脑休眠/唤醒时电视自动开关机
- OLED屏幕保护:检测用户空闲时自动保护屏幕
- 多显示器智能管理:自动响应显示器拓扑变化
- 强大的命令行控制:支持数百个命令参数
- 丰富的API接口:便于脚本和第三方应用集成
LGTV Companion安装界面采用复古未来主义设计,左侧经典CRT电视与霓虹网格背景的对比,象征着传统电视与现代智能控制的完美融合
🔧 快速入门:4步完成智能联动配置
第一步:环境准备与网络设置
在开始安装前,确保满足以下基本条件:
- 网络环境:电视和电脑必须在同一局域网内
- 电视设置:启用"通过Wi-Fi开机"功能(无论使用有线还是无线连接)
- 路由器配置:为电视设置静态IP地址(DHCP保留)
专业提示:不同型号的LG电视,"通过Wi-Fi开机"功能位置不同:
- CX系列:设置→通用→设备→外部设备→通过移动设备开机
- C1/C2/C3/C4系列:设置→通用→设备→外部设备→TV On With Mobile→Turn on via Wi-Fi
第二步:软件安装与组件介绍
从项目发布页面下载最新安装程序,双击运行即可。安装过程包含三个核心组件:
- LGTV Companion服务:后台运行的核心服务,负责监控系统事件
- 用户界面程序:配置管理界面,提供直观的操作界面
- 桌面守护进程:用户模式下的智能监控程序
第三步:设备扫描与配对连接
- 从Windows开始菜单打开"LGTV Companion"
- 点击"扫描"按钮自动发现网络中的LG电视
- 如果自动扫描失败,手动输入电视的IP地址和MAC地址
- 电视屏幕上会出现配对请求,确认即可完成连接
第四步:核心功能配置与优化
在主要配置界面中,关注以下关键设置:
- 自动设备管理:启用后自动响应电源事件
- 用户空闲模式:检测到用户离开时自动保护屏幕
- 关机设置:根据系统语言配置正确的关机/重启识别词
🎮 四大使用场景的智能解决方案
1. 游戏玩家的沉浸式体验优化
对于游戏玩家,每一帧延迟都至关重要。LGTV Companion可以配置为:
- 游戏启动自动切换:自动切换到游戏模式降低输入延迟
- 智能画面优化:根据游戏类型调整HDR、对比度等参数
- 电源状态同步:电脑休眠时电视自动关闭,唤醒时自动开启
核心源码:LGTV Companion Service/companion.cpp
2. 办公用户的高效工作流
在办公场景中,LGTV Companion能显著提升效率:
- 会议演示自动化:连接投影仪时自动打开电视并切换到演示模式
- 多显示器智能管理:自动识别显示器拓扑结构变化
- 节能环保:非工作时间自动关闭电视,减少能源浪费
3. 影音爱好者的沉浸式观影
对于追求极致影音体验的用户:
- 影院模式自动切换:播放视频时自动优化画面和声音设置
- 环境光适应:根据房间光线自动调整背光亮度
- 观影时间管理:设定观影时间后自动关闭电视
4. 开发者的强大自动化平台
开发者可以利用LGTV Companion的丰富API:
- 脚本自动化:通过命令行或脚本实现自定义控制逻辑
- 事件监听:实时监控电视状态变化并触发相应动作
- 第三方集成:与其他智能家居系统无缝对接
官方文档:Docs/Scripting.md
📊 技术架构与核心模块
LGTV Companion采用模块化设计,确保稳定性和扩展性:
核心服务模块
- 事件监控系统:实时监听Windows系统事件(休眠、唤醒、用户空闲等)
- 网络通信层:处理与LG电视的WebOS API通信
- 配置管理系统:管理用户设置和设备配置
用户界面组件
- 设备管理界面:添加、删除和配置电视设备
- 设置面板:调整全局参数和个性化选项
- 状态监控:实时显示设备连接状态和活动日志
命令行工具
提供完整的命令行接口,支持数百个参数,满足高级用户和自动化需求:
# 基本控制命令 LGTVcli.exe -poweron LGTVcli.exe -set_input HDMI_1 LGTVcli.exe -volume 50官方文档:Docs/Commandline.md
🔍 常见问题与解决方案
问题一:电视无法被扫描发现
可能原因:
- 电视与电脑不在同一网络子网
- 电视的"通过Wi-Fi开机"功能未启用
- 防火墙阻止了网络发现
解决方案:
- 检查网络配置,确保设备在同一子网
- 确认电视设置中的相关功能已开启
- 暂时关闭防火墙测试,或添加例外规则
问题二:电视无法正常开关机
可能原因:
- 网络唤醒(WOL)配置不正确
- 电视固件版本过旧
- 路由器设置阻止了魔法包广播
解决方案:
- 尝试不同的唤醒选项(发送到IP地址或广播)
- 更新电视到最新固件版本
- 检查路由器是否允许跨子网广播
问题三:自动模式切换不工作
可能原因:
- 应用程序检测逻辑不匹配
- 电视API限制
- 脚本配置错误
解决方案:
- 检查事件日志确认检测是否正常
- 参考官方文档确认电视型号支持的功能
- 使用内置日志功能调试脚本执行
🚀 进阶技巧:释放全部潜力
技巧一:利用命令行实现批量操作
通过命令行接口,你可以实现批量设备管理和复杂控制逻辑:
# 批量控制所有设备 LGTVcli.exe -poweron_all LGTVcli.exe -set_all_input HDMI_1技巧二:创建自定义自动化脚本
结合系统任务计划程序,创建基于时间或事件的自动化脚本:
示例脚本:Docs/Example scripts/
技巧三:集成到智能家居系统
通过LGTV Companion的API,你可以将其集成到Home Assistant、OpenHAB等智能家居平台中,实现更复杂的场景联动。
📈 渐进式学习路径
新手阶段:掌握基础自动化(1-2周)
目标:实现电视与电脑的基本电源同步
- 学习使用图形界面配置基本功能
- 理解自动扫描和手动添加设备的区别
- 测试电源开关功能确保正常工作
进阶阶段:个性化场景配置(2-4周)
目标:根据使用场景定制自动化规则
- 探索命令行接口的基本用法
- 学习如何基于应用程序切换电视模式
- 配置多显示器环境下的智能管理
专家阶段:深度集成与扩展(1个月以上)
目标:实现复杂的自动化工作流
- 掌握完整的命令行参数体系
- 开发自定义脚本实现特定功能
- 集成到其他自动化系统或智能家居平台
🛡️ 安全与稳定性保障
安全第一的设计理念
LGTV Companion在设计时充分考虑了安全性:
- 本地网络通信:所有数据都在局域网内传输,不涉及互联网
- 最小权限原则:应用程序只请求必要的系统权限
- 代码签名验证:所有发布版本都经过数字签名验证
稳定的系统兼容性
经过广泛测试,LGTV Companion兼容:
- Windows 10/11所有主流版本
- LG WebOS 3.0及以上版本
- 多种网络配置(有线/无线)
🌟 为什么选择LGTV Companion?
开源优势
- 完全免费:无需支付任何费用
- 代码透明:所有源代码公开,安全可靠
- 社区支持:活跃的用户社区和开发者支持
专业特性
- 智能OLED保护:专门为OLED屏幕设计,防止烧屏
- 多设备支持:支持同时管理多台LG电视
- 高度可定制:丰富的配置选项满足不同需求
易用性
- 直观界面:简洁的用户界面,易于配置
- 自动发现:自动扫描网络中的LG电视
- 详细文档:完整的文档和示例脚本
📋 系统要求与安装指南
最低系统要求
- 操作系统:Windows 10或更高版本
- 网络:有线或无线局域网
- 电视要求:LG WebOS 3.0及以上版本
安装步骤
- 从项目页面下载最新安装程序
- 双击运行安装程序,按照向导完成安装
- 首次运行时进行设备扫描和配对
- 根据使用场景配置自动化规则
重要提示:安装过程中Windows Defender可能会阻止下载。如果遇到此问题,请右键点击安装程序,选择"属性",在"常规"选项卡底部勾选"解除锁定"复选框。
🎉 开始你的智能电视管理之旅
LGTV Companion代表了电视与电脑协同工作的未来方向。它不仅仅是一个工具,更是一种全新的使用理念——让设备服务于人,而不是让人适应设备。
无论你是为了保护昂贵的OLED电视,还是为了提升工作效率,或是单纯追求更智能的生活体验,LGTV Companion都能为你带来实实在在的价值。它的开源特性意味着你可以完全掌控自己的设备,根据需求进行定制和扩展。
下一步行动建议:
- 克隆项目仓库:
git clone https://gitcode.com/gh_mirrors/lg/LGTVCompanion - 下载最新版本安装程序
- 按照指南完成基础安装配置
- 从最简单的自动化场景开始尝试
- 逐步探索更高级的功能和定制选项
记住,最好的自动化是那些你几乎注意不到,但一旦缺失就会明显感受到不便的自动化。LGTV Companion正是为了创造这种"隐形但重要"的体验而生。
开始你的智能电视管理之旅吧,让技术真正为你的生活和工作服务!
【免费下载链接】LGTVCompanionPower On and Off WebOS LG TVs together with your PC项目地址: https://gitcode.com/gh_mirrors/lg/LGTVCompanion
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考